Mandeep Sandhu wrote:
> I'm a first-timer with ecos.
>
> I've downloaded ecos (along with the pre-built GNU toolchains -
> arm-eabi) using the "ecos-install.tcl" script.
>
> As per instructions I made a new "build" dir and tried to run
> "configure" from inside it.
You need to use either the GUI eCos Configuration Tool or the
command-line "ecosconfig" tool to configure the eCos run-time code. Ref:
http://ecos.sourceware.org/docs-latest/user-guide/configuring-and-building-ecos-from-source.html
